The Emergence of Virtual Reality Casinos
Virtual reality technology has made significant strides over the past few years, becoming more accessible and affordable for consumers worldwide. The integration of VR into the casino industry is a natural progression, aiming to attract a younger demographic of tech-savvy gamblers while offering novel experiences to seasoned players. VR casinos replicate the atmosphere of a land-based casino with stunning detail, allowing players to walk through digitally recreated casino floors, interact with other players and live dealers, and play their favorite casino games with the added depth of virtual reality.
What Makes VR Casinos Exceptional?
-
Immersive Environment: Unlike traditional online platforms, VR casinos offer a three-dimensional environment that mimics the real world. Every aspect, from the detailed casino decor to the sound of chips clinking, enhances the user's immersion. This environment makes simple actions like pulling a slot machine handle or throwing dice a much more engaging experience.
-
Interactivity: VR casinos stand out with their high level of interactivity. Players can use their virtual hands to place bets, hold cards, or even order a virtual cocktail at the bar. The ability to interact not just with the game elements but also with other players adds a social dimension that is often missing in online gambling.
-
Realistic Casino Games: From blackjack and poker to slots and roulette, the games in VR casinos are designed to mimic their real-world counterparts closely. Advanced graphics and physics engines ensure that the spin of the roulette wheel, the shuffle of cards, and the movement of dice are incredibly realistic, providing a gaming experience that rivals physical presence in a casino.
Challenges and Opportunities
Despite the exciting possibilities, VR casinos face several challenges. The requirement for VR headsets and potentially high-powered computers can be a barrier for some users. Additionally, there are questions about regulations and the security of gambling in a virtual space that need to be addressed to ensure fair play and the protection of users’ data.
However, these challenges also present opportunities. For instance, the development of more affordable and comfortable VR equipment could accelerate the widespread adoption of VR casinos. Moreover, ongoing advancements in VR technology continue to improve user experience and expand potential functionalities within these virtual environments.
